I haven't been to their stadium, but it's in a nice area of the city. Of course, it's still a footbal crowd. Try to go with some locals, if you know some people.

If you're going by yourself, and you're not too familiar with Argentine football, go to La Platea, stay away from La Popular. (The standing area behind the goals). Also you probably want to stay away from the area designated for the visiting team, you want everybody to know you're a fan of Tigre (or whoever the local team is.)

Of course, nobody can garantee your safety, but usually nothing happens. You should be safe, as long as you don't do anything dumb, like for example take an expensive watch and camera, or wear the colors of the opposition, or exchange words with one of the barra bravas.

If you go to the Tigre area, you should also consider taking a boat tour of the Parana Delta. It's a cool trip.

I've been going to the stadium lately, and i'll be there tomorrow. To what i can tell the "popular" of Tigre ain't dangerous or anything, at least to what i can see, actually it's divided in 2 sections, the big stand behind the keep which is the true "popular" and the other stand(the one i always go to) which is under the commentator boxes(the one that doesn't let you see the sideline on TV) and to be honest it looks more family friendly than the majority of the stadiums, also as Tigre's stadium has a single "platea" section it is too expensive compared with the other stand(the platea ticket costs 80 pesos compared with the popular which only costs 25). According to what i've heard there is possible expansion in mind because the stadium has capacity for 32,000 people but it seems it doesn't hold enough people anymore to fit the needs of Tigre supporters.
